Transmission Shifting 900 1995

1995 940 Non Turbo Wagon
Auto with overdrive
197,000 miles

Just acquired my Svedish Brik a couple days ago and I'm starting to love it. Although, I have one question for those who have owned before me. I'm concerned that I may have a transmission problem. My shift points between gears are around 3700-4000RPM, regardless of acceleration rate, which makes for some rough shifts at times. I know that Chrysler had a tranny in the late 80's which would learn the pattern of the driver and adjust accordingly. Does Volvo have anything like this, anyone have any ideas on how I can readjust this to a smoother transition point, or am I looking at some major problems?
